Is there any legal requirement to have home insurance for your house?



Is there any legal requirement to have home insurance for your house?

It is not a law per say. However the lender who holds the lien on your house may require that you carry insurance. If you currently obtained your loan the Truth & Lending Doc will have a box marked to indicate if the insurance is in fact manditory. Source(s): Loan Processor

No. But, if you have a mortgage, the bank will require you to carry insurance. If you do not, the bank will buy insurance then charge the premiums back to you.
The above answer is correct in indicating that it is not a law. HOWEVER, if you have a mortgage your lender will require coverage, and if you are in a High Risk Flood Zone it is MANDATORY that your lender require you to carry Flood Insurance.

Also, even if you own your home outright I would recommend that you carry insurance on your home. For most people their home is their biggest investment, you'd hate to lose it due to an unforeseen event! Fire, Flood, Hurricane, Water Damage etc...
